What is the difference between Internship Teamcenter Developer vs Junior Teamcenter Developer?

AspectInternship Teamcenter DeveloperJunior Teamcenter Developer
CredentialsTypically pursuing or recently completed relevant degree or certificationEntry-level professional with basic certifications or experience
Work EnvironmentInternship programs, training projects, supervised tasksFull-time employment, project development, team collaboration
Industry UsageUsed as a training position in manufacturing and engineering firmsStandard role in companies utilizing Teamcenter PLM systems

The main difference is that an Internship Teamcenter Developer is a temporary, training-focused position for students or recent graduates, while a Junior Teamcenter Developer is an entry-level professional working full-time on real projects. Internships provide learning opportunities, whereas junior roles involve contributing to ongoing development tasks within a team.

Job's mission

A highly skilled and detail-oriented Component Engineer to ensure the reliability and lifecycle integrity of electrical and mechanical components within ASM's modules. In this pivotal role, you will drive innovation through strategic component selection, rigorous qualification processes, and proactive lifecycle management. Collaborating closely with cross-functional teams, you will optimize performance, cost efficiency, and supply chain resilience while upholding the highest standards of reliability.

If you thrive in a fast-paced, global environment and have a passion for cutting-edge electronics, we invite you to apply and become an integral part of our mission.


What you will be working on
  • Identify, evaluate, and recommend engineering components for new and current product designs.
  • Establish and maintain strong relationships with suppliers to ensure high-quality sourcing.
  • Optimize component selection for performance, cost-effectiveness, and long-term availability.
  • Ensure components meet industry and regulatory standards (e.g., RoHS, UL, ISO).
  • Ensure compliance with industry and regulatory standards, including RoHS, UL, and ISO.
  • Conduct failure analysis and root cause investigations for non-conforming components.
  • Collaborate with design teams to validate component performance in real-world applications.
  • Maintain accurate and up-to-date component libraries and part specifications.
  • Ensure adherence to environmental, safety, and regulatory requirements.
  • Work closely with supply chain teams to identify alternative components and mitigate risks related to obsolescence or shortages.
  • Liaise with external manufacturers to resolve technical issues and optimize sourcing strategies.
  • Perform cost-benefit analysis to optimize component selection without compromising quality.
  • Proactively identify alternative components to address potential supply chain disruptions.
  • Manage change orders and develop mitigation strategies for component lifecycle risks.
  • Proven hands-on experience in component selection, qualification, and supplier coordination.
  • Expertise in failure analysis, component lifecycle management, and industry standards.
  • Familiarity with failure analysis and component lifecycle management.
  • Strong understanding of electronic components and their applications in circuit design.
  • Function as a subject matter expert responsible for the lifecycle management of both electronic and mechanical components.
What we are looking for
  • Bachelor's degree in mechanical, Electrical, or Industrial Engineering (or related field).
  • Up to 3 years of experience in engineering or technical project management (internships and co-ops count).
  • Coursework or exposure to Systems Engineering, Project Management, Industrial Engineering, or Supply Chain.
  • Familiarity with PLM systems (e.g., Teamcenter) and ERP systems (e.g., SAP S4 Hana).
  • Basic proficiency in 3D CAD modeling (e.g., CREO).
  • Understanding of ASME Y14.5 GD&T practices.
